I use LibreELEC running on an RPi 3 as my primary NextPVR user interface/client. I have the recording devices mapped as SMB drives from my NextPVR server to the RPi and use advancedsettings.xml with path substitution redirect the player to access the .ts files directly from the SMB drives rather than via NextPVR's HTTP streaming (in order to get .edl skipping support).

Recently I've been having problems with several recordings where the playback will stall for various lengths of time. Sometimes Kodi will display a Buffering message. Other times it just stalls for a while before beginning playing again. Often this happens during/after a commercial skip or a manual skip forward during playback. So far, I haven't been able to track down the cause. I don't think that it is network/hardware related. It seems more like it is related to the contents of the .ts file because some files will exhibit this problem multiple times during playback and other files will play just fine.

I just updated to the latest LibreELEC Beta (v. 1.95.2) and am still having the problem. When the problem happens, the kodi.log file is showing some/all of these errors:
Code:
WARNING: CRenderManager::WaitForBuffer - timeout waiting for buffer
ERROR: CDVDAudio::AddPacketsRenderer - timeout adding data to renderer
ERROR: Previous line repeats 73 times.
NOTICE: CVideoPlayerAudio::Process - stream stalled

And when this situation just happened while playing a file, I turned on debugging (at 14:43:42 in the attached kodi.log), continued waiting and watching through a couple of skips, and then zipped the attached logs.

I'm wondering if anyone else is seeing similar problems or has ideas about where I look next to try to fix the issue(s).

Another discovery: During automatic commercial skipping, if I display the timeline on the screen while playback is "stalled", it shows the current position proceeding through commercial section in real-time (while the audio and video are black). And then when it gets to the end of the commercial section, there is a brief "stutter" and then playback continues normally.

Actually, it seems to be a LibreELEC (or more likely) Kodi problem. I had posted about it in the LibreELEC forum here https://forum.libreelec.tv/thread-4546.html and pavlov70 reported seeing the same behavior with an Intel NUC playing recordings from a MythTV backend.

I downgraded back to LibreELEC 7.95.1 and it is doing the auto skip OK again. I think that there may be something file related as I was occassionally getting this sort of behavior with a few files with pre-7.95.2 versions. But when I went to 7.95.2, it was consistently happening with every file that I played. Weird. And annoying!

Yes it seems to be a Kodi problem, in later Krypton versions and I see it on other platform outside LE. https://github.com/xbmc/xbmc/pull/11646 The fix is out for Leia but nothing about a Krypon backport yet.
